(Fargo, ND) -- Students at the Trollwood School of Performing Arts in Fargo will be performing their annual main stage musical beginning Thursday night, following a one-year hiatus.
"It's just an awesome show. Lots of high energy, these kids are phenomenally talented. It's just going to be a wonderful show," said Trollwood's Executive Director Kathy Anderson.
Trollwood's Executive Director Kathy Anderson says "Singin' in The Rain" will open tomorrow night at 8:30 at the Bluestem Amphitheater in Moorhead.
That production was canceled last year because of a lack of skilled production workers and inflationary pressures.
"Singin' in the Rain" runs through July.
